Ocean Morisset born on November 18, 1969 is a self-taught, Haitian-American freelance photographer living in New York City. Ocean carries the name of his paternal great grandfather, who left him a legacy of pride and interest in his Haitian ancestry. His pursuit of a photography career was temporarily deferred by Operation Desert Storm. He is a Veteran of the United States Air Force Reserves, having served as a Medical Service Specialist in Operation Desert Storm (1990-91).
